Is it good to wear earplugs while sleeping?

Earplugs don’t damage your hearing. You can use them every night provided you pay attention to hygiene—your hands should be washed and dried before inserting to prevent risk of outer ear infection. You should make sure that no earwax accumulates and that you don’t suffer from an ear infection.

Why have Bose Sleepbuds been discontinued?

Last year Bose took the dramatic step of discontinuing the original Sleepbuds because of inconsistent battery performance and the device not charging fully or powering down unexpectedly or both. The Bose SleepBuds II will be available from October 13 and will be priced at $379.95.

What is the difference between Bose Sleepbuds 1 and 2?

And the Sleepbuds II use a new antenna for an improved, more stable connection with your phone. The battery was the downfall for the first-generation Sleepbuds, and Bose says it’s using a new NiMH battery that’s good for 10 hours of playback. (The aluminum charging case is good for an additional 30 hours.)
